package fr.cnes.regards.modules.acquisition.service.plugins;
import com.google.gson.Gson;
import com.google.gson.stream.JsonReader;
import fr.cnes.regards.framework.geojson.Feature;
import fr.cnes.regards.framework.geojson.FeatureCollection;
import fr.cnes.regards.framework.modules.plugins.annotations.Plugin;
import fr.cnes.regards.framework.modules.plugins.annotations.PluginParameter;
import fr.cnes.regards.framework.urn.DataType;
import fr.cnes.regards.framework.utils.file.ChecksumUtils;
import fr.cnes.regards.framework.utils.plugins.PluginUtilsRuntimeException;
import fr.cnes.regards.modules.acquisition.plugins.IScanPlugin;
import fr.cnes.regards.modules.ingest.dto.sip.SIP;
import fr.cnes.regards.modules.ingest.dto.sip.SIPBuilder;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.http.MediaType;
import java.io.File;
import java.io.FileInputStream;
import java.io.IOException;
import java.io.InputStreamReader;
import java.nio.charset.Charset;
import java.nio.file.DirectoryStream;
import java.nio.file.Files;
import java.nio.file.Path;
import java.nio.file.Paths;
import java.security.NoSuchAlgorithmException;
import java.time.OffsetDateTime;
import java.time.ZoneOffset;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.List;
import java.util.Optional;
/**
* This plugin allows to scan a directory to find geojson files and generate a new file to acquire for each feature found in it.
*
* @author Sébastien Binda
*/
@Plugin(id = "GeoJsonFeatureCollectionParserPlugin",
version = "1.0.0-SNAPSHOT",
description = "Scan directory to detect geosjson files. Generate a file to acquire for each feature found in it.",
author = "REGARDS Team",
contact = "regards@c-s.fr",
license = "GPLv3",
owner = "CSSI",
url = "https://github.com/RegardsOss")
public class GeoJsonFeatureCollectionParserPlugin implements IScanPlugin {
private static final Logger LOGGER = LoggerFactory.getLogger(GlobDiskScanning.class);
public static final String FIELD_FEATURE_ID = "featureId";
public static final String ALLOW_EMPTY_FEATURES = "allowEmptyFeatures";
@Autowired
private Gson gson;
@PluginParameter(name = FIELD_FEATURE_ID,
label = "Json path to access the identifier of each feature in the geojson file",
optional = false)
private String featureId;
@PluginParameter(name = ALLOW_EMPTY_FEATURES,
label = "Generate features with no files (raw, thumbnail & description) associated.",
optional = true,
defaultValue = "false")
private boolean allowEmptyFeature;
@Override
public List<Path> scan(Path dirPath, Optional<OffsetDateTime> scanningDate) {
List<Path> scannedFiles = new ArrayList<>();
if (Files.isDirectory(dirPath)) {
scannedFiles.addAll(scanDirectory(dirPath, scanningDate));
} else {
throw new PluginUtilsRuntimeException(String.format("Invalid directory path : %s", dirPath.toString()));
}
return scannedFiles;
}
private List<Path> scanDirectory(Path dirPath, Optional<OffsetDateTime> scanningDate) {
List<Path> genetateFeatureFiles = new ArrayList<>();
try (DirectoryStream<Path> stream = Files.newDirectoryStream(dirPath, "*.geojson")) {
for (Path entry : stream) {
if (Files.isRegularFile(entry)) {
if (scanningDate.isPresent()) {
OffsetDateTime lmd = OffsetDateTime.ofInstant(Files.getLastModifiedTime(entry).toInstant(),
ZoneOffset.UTC);
if (lmd.isAfter(scanningDate.get()) || lmd.isEqual(scanningDate.get())) {
genetateFeatureFiles.addAll(generateFeatureFiles(entry));
}
} else {
genetateFeatureFiles.addAll(generateFeatureFiles(entry));
}
}
}
} catch (IOException x) {
throw new PluginUtilsRuntimeException("Scanning failure", x);
}
return genetateFeatureFiles;
}
private List<Path> generateFeatureFiles(Path entry) {
List<Path> generatedFiles = new ArrayList<>();
try {
// Check if file is a gson feature collection
File gsonFile = entry.toFile();
JsonReader reader = new JsonReader(new InputStreamReader(new FileInputStream(gsonFile)));
FeatureCollection fc = gson.fromJson(reader, FeatureCollection.class);
for (Feature feature : fc.getFeatures()) {
String name = (String) feature.getProperties().get(featureId);
SIPBuilder builder = new SIPBuilder(name);
for (String property : feature.getProperties().keySet()) {
Object value = feature.getProperties().get(property);
if (value != null) {
builder.addDescriptiveInformation(property, value);
}
}
// Check for RAWDATA if any
Path rawDataFile = Paths.get(entry.getParent().toString(), name + ".dat");
Path thumbnailFilePng = Paths.get(entry.getParent().toString(), name + ".png");
Path thumbnailFileJpg = Paths.get(entry.getParent().toString(), name + ".jpg");
Path descFile = Paths.get(entry.getParent().toString(), name + ".pdf");
if (Files.exists(rawDataFile)) {
String checksum = ChecksumUtils.computeHexChecksum(new FileInputStream(rawDataFile.toFile()),
"MD5");
builder.getContentInformationBuilder()
.setDataObject(DataType.RAWDATA,
rawDataFile.toAbsolutePath(),
rawDataFile.getFileName().toString(),
"MD5",
checksum,
rawDataFile.toFile().length());
builder.getContentInformationBuilder().setSyntax(MediaType.APPLICATION_OCTET_STREAM);
builder.addContentInformation();
}
if (Files.exists(thumbnailFilePng)) {
String checksum = ChecksumUtils.computeHexChecksum(new FileInputStream(thumbnailFilePng.toFile()),
"MD5");
builder.getContentInformationBuilder()
.setDataObject(DataType.THUMBNAIL,
thumbnailFilePng.toAbsolutePath(),
thumbnailFilePng.getFileName().toString(),
"MD5",
checksum,
thumbnailFilePng.toFile().length());
builder.getContentInformationBuilder().setSyntax(MediaType.IMAGE_PNG);
builder.addContentInformation();
builder.getContentInformationBuilder()
.setDataObject(DataType.QUICKLOOK_SD,
thumbnailFilePng.toAbsolutePath(),
thumbnailFilePng.getFileName().toString(),
"MD5",
checksum,
thumbnailFilePng.toFile().length());
builder.getContentInformationBuilder().setSyntax(MediaType.IMAGE_PNG);
builder.addContentInformation();
}
if (Files.exists(thumbnailFileJpg)) {
String checksum = ChecksumUtils.computeHexChecksum(new FileInputStream(thumbnailFileJpg.toFile()),
"MD5");
builder.getContentInformationBuilder()
.setDataObject(DataType.THUMBNAIL,
thumbnailFileJpg.toAbsolutePath(),
thumbnailFileJpg.getFileName().toString(),
"MD5",
checksum,
thumbnailFileJpg.toFile().length());
builder.getContentInformationBuilder().setSyntax(MediaType.IMAGE_PNG);
builder.addContentInformation();
builder.getContentInformationBuilder()
.setDataObject(DataType.QUICKLOOK_SD,
thumbnailFileJpg.toAbsolutePath(),
thumbnailFileJpg.getFileName().toString(),
"MD5",
checksum,
thumbnailFileJpg.toFile().length());
builder.getContentInformationBuilder().setSyntax(MediaType.IMAGE_PNG);
builder.addContentInformation();
}
if (Files.exists(descFile)) {
String checksum = ChecksumUtils.computeHexChecksum(new FileInputStream(descFile.toFile()), "MD5");
builder.getContentInformationBuilder()
.setDataObject(DataType.DESCRIPTION,
descFile.toAbsolutePath(),
descFile.getFileName().toString(),
"MD5",
checksum,
descFile.toFile().length());
builder.getContentInformationBuilder().setSyntax(MediaType.APPLICATION_PDF);
builder.addContentInformation();
}
SIP sip = builder.build();
sip.setGeometry(feature.getGeometry());
if (!sip.getProperties().getContentInformations().isEmpty() || allowEmptyFeature) {
Path file = Paths.get(entry.getParent().toString(), name + ".json");
generatedFiles.add(Files.write(file, Arrays.asList(gson.toJson(sip)), Charset.forName("UTF-8")));
}
}
} catch (IOException | NoSuchAlgorithmException e) {
LOGGER.error(e.getMessage(), e);
}
return generatedFiles;
}
public void setGson(Gson gson) {
this.gson = gson;
}
public void setFeatureId(String featureId) {
this.featureId = featureId;
}
}
